How the System Works
The Cool Down system ingeniously taps into the cooler temperatures typically found in basements. By drawing this naturally cool air into living spaces, the system effectively lowers indoor temperatures during the sweltering summer months. In addition, it manages excess heat by transferring it back into the ground, ensuring that homes remain comfortable without the burden of high electricity bills.
